Human Resources

Welcome! The Human Resources Office coordinates all personnel functions pertaining to the College’s support staff, serves as a resource area for addressing personnel matters affecting all employees and manages employee benefit programs.

Our office is located in the Centennial House at 320 Maple Street. Office hours are 8 a.m. to 5 p.m. Monday through Friday. Our telephone number is (989) 463-7314 and our fax number is (989) 463-7787.

Alma College’s nationally recognized Model United Nations program has won top honors for 16 consecutive years (1997–2012) — the longest active winning streak of any college or university in the nation. Alma College’s all-time 30 “outstanding delegation” awards are the most of any college or university in the 90-year history of the conference.

Dr. Carol Bender

Dr. Carol Bender
Departments: English

Dr. Carol Bender, professor of English, has had a special interest in African-American literature since her guest professorship at Stillman College in Tuscaloosa, Alabama, where the faculty she worked with had tremendous expertise in the subject. Much of her professional writing and scholarship focuses on black women writers such as Gwendolyn Brooks and Gloria Naylor.

Her other interest, women’s literature, stems from her curiosity in women’s studies, a program she and a colleague started at Alma in 1992.
